编程班一般教什么内容
-
编程班一般会教授一系列与计算机编程相关的内容。以下是一些常见的编程班教授的内容:
-
编程基础知识:编程班通常会从基础开始,教授编程的基本概念和原理,例如变量、数据类型、运算符、控制流程等。学生将学习如何编写简单的程序,并理解程序的执行过程。
-
编程语言:编程班会教授一种或多种编程语言,如Python、Java、C++等。学生将学习编程语言的语法和语义,以及如何使用语言的各种功能和库。
-
数据结构和算法:编程班会介绍一些基本的数据结构,如数组、链表、栈、队列和树等。学生将学习如何使用这些数据结构来解决实际问题,并学习一些常见的算法,如排序和搜索算法。
-
网络编程:随着互联网的普及,网络编程成为了重要的技能。编程班会教授一些网络编程的基本概念和技术,如HTTP、TCP/IP、Socket编程等。
-
数据库:编程班会介绍一些常见的数据库系统,如MySQL、Oracle等,并教授如何设计和使用数据库,以及如何使用SQL语言进行数据操作。
-
前端开发:编程班可能会涉及一些前端开发的内容,如HTML、CSS和JavaScript等。学生将学习如何构建用户界面,并了解一些常用的前端框架和工具。
-
后端开发:编程班也会教授一些后端开发的知识,如服务器端的编程、数据库操作等。学生将学习如何构建和维护服务器端的应用程序。
除了以上内容,编程班还可能会涉及其他领域的知识,如人工智能、机器学习、数据分析等,以满足不同学生的需求。编程班的内容通常会根据学生的水平和目标进行调整,并且会不断更新,以跟上技术的发展。
1年前 -
-
编程班一般教授以下内容:
-
编程基础知识:编程班通常会从基础知识开始教授,包括编程语言的语法、数据类型、变量、循环、条件语句等。学生会学习如何编写简单的程序,并了解程序的执行过程和基本编程概念。
-
数据结构与算法:学生会学习各种常见的数据结构,如数组、链表、栈、队列、树等,并了解它们的特点和应用场景。此外,学生还会学习一些常用的算法,如排序算法、查找算法、图算法等,以及如何分析算法的时间复杂度和空间复杂度。
-
网络编程:随着互联网的发展,网络编程成为了编程班的重要内容之一。学生会学习如何使用网络协议进行数据传输,如HTTP、TCP/IP等,并了解如何使用常见的网络编程框架进行开发。此外,学生还会学习如何处理网络异常、优化网络性能等相关知识。
-
数据库:学生会学习关系型数据库和非关系型数据库的基本概念和使用方法,如MySQL、MongoDB等。他们会学习如何设计和创建数据库表,以及如何使用SQL语言进行数据库操作。此外,学生还会学习如何使用ORM框架进行数据库操作,以提高开发效率。
-
Web开发:Web开发是编程班中的重要内容之一。学生会学习HTML、CSS和JavaScript等前端技术,以及常见的前端框架和库,如React、Vue等。此外,学生还会学习后端开发的基础知识,如Web服务器的搭建、API的设计与开发等。他们还会学习如何使用常见的Web框架进行开发,如Django、Spring等。
除了上述内容,编程班还会根据学生的需求和兴趣,教授一些其他的编程技术和工具,如移动应用开发、人工智能、大数据处理等。编程班的目标是培养学生的编程能力和解决问题的能力,使他们能够独立进行软件开发,并为他们未来的职业发展打下坚实的基础。
1年前 -
-
编程班一般会教授一系列与计算机编程相关的知识和技能,从基础知识到高级应用都会有涉及。以下是编程班通常教授的内容:
-
编程语言基础:编程班通常会教授多种编程语言的基础知识,比如Python、Java、C++等。学生将学习语法、变量、数据类型、运算符、控制结构等基本概念。
-
数据结构与算法:学习数据结构和算法是编程的核心部分。编程班会教授各种数据结构,如数组、链表、栈、队列、树、图等,以及常见算法,如排序、搜索、递归等。
-
网络编程和数据库:编程班通常会涉及网络编程和数据库的知识。学生将学习如何通过编程与服务器进行通信,以及如何使用数据库进行数据存储和查询。
-
前端开发:随着互联网的发展,前端开发变得越来越重要。编程班会教授HTML、CSS和JavaScript等前端技术,让学生能够构建网页和交互式用户界面。
-
后端开发:编程班也会涉及后端开发的知识,如服务器端编程、API设计、数据库管理等。学生将学习如何构建Web应用程序和服务器端应用程序。
-
移动应用开发:移动应用开发也是编程班的一部分。学生将学习如何使用Android或iOS平台开发移动应用程序,并学习与移动设备交互的技术。
-
软件工程:编程班也会教授软件工程的知识,如需求分析、设计模式、版本控制等。学生将学习如何进行软件项目的规划、设计和管理。
-
实践项目:编程班通常会有实践项目,让学生将所学知识应用于实际项目中。通过实践,学生可以锻炼编程能力和解决问题的能力。
编程班的具体内容可能会有所不同,取决于教学机构的设置和学生的需求。但总的来说,编程班的目标是培养学生的编程能力和解决问题的能力,让他们能够在计算机行业中有所作为。
1年前 -